Graduate Structural Analysis Engineer – Aerospace - Bristol/Hybrid- Β£30,000-Β£40,000

Start Your Aerospace Engineering Career and be exposed to the leading technology on the market.

Are you a recent Mechanical or Aerospace Engineering graduate looking to put your degree into practice?

We're looking for a Graduate Structural Analysis Engineer to join a talented aerospace team working on cutting-edge technology across Defence, Security and Space.

You'll gain hands-on experience in structural analysis, FEA and testing, working alongside experienced engineers and contributing to real aerospace programmes from concept through to manufacture.

What You'll Do

  • Perform structural and static strength analysis of metallic and composite components.
  • Build and post-process FEA models using tools such as Nastran, ANSYS and Altair.
  • Support structural testing and correlate analysis with test results.
  • Produce technical stress reports and engineering substantiation.
  • Work closely with design, manufacturing and test teams.
  • Develop your technical skills and take increasing responsibility as you progress.
